This sustainable dining space for West Sussex County Council was completed in June 2012. Fordingbridge were comissioned to design and build this building as part of a government initiative to provide hot meals to primary school children accross the country. The building includes a kitchen space, toilet facilities and a large dining hall which can be split into two independant teaching spaces.
Features include:
• A sustainably sourced FSC accredited glu-laminated timber-frame.
• low maintanance highly insulated composite panel walls and roof. Joints are sealed for airtightness to reduce heat loss from the building.
• A natural ventilation system creates a pleasant environment with no energy demand.
• An underfloor heating system supplied by an air source heat pump. this system provides a comfortable even heat with exceptionally low energy demand.
• Argon filled triple glazed window units with low emission coating.
